PodMan — Real-time AI Team Coordination Agent

2026 AI Engineer World's Fair Hackathon — Track: Continual Learning

PodMan is an ambient AI teammate. Engineers join a pod room with earbuds in. Each engineer's browser PWA captures their screen every 30 seconds. PodMan watches, understands what each person is working on, detects coordination gaps — blockers, dependencies, duplicate work — and speaks up proactively before anyone has to ask.

"Carol, looks like you're waiting on auth. Alice is actively building it — hang tight." "Carol, Bob — Alice just got the auth endpoint running. You're clear to integrate."

Nobody sent a message. Nobody pinged on Slack. PodMan just knew.


How it works

  1. Engineers open the PWA in their browser and join a pod room
  2. PWA captures a screen frame every 30s via getDisplayMedia, POSTs it to Hermes
  3. Hermes (server-side orchestrator) calls Gemini Vision to extract structured context per engineer — current file, inferred task, terminal state
  4. Hermes writes context to MongoDB Atlas, updates the ownership map
  5. Hermes runs event detection across all engineers — dependency ready, blocker, duplicate work
  6. When an event fires, Hermes generates a spoken nudge and publishes it into the LiveKit room via Gemini Live 2.5
  7. Engineers hear PodMan through their earbuds

The ownership map persists across sessions — making PodMan faster and smarter each time the team works together.


Monorepo layout

Folder What
frontend/ React + Vite PWA — join pod, screen capture, nudge feed, live teammate status
backend/ Hermes orchestrator: /ingest endpoint, Gemini vision pipeline, event detector, LiveKit agent
database/ MongoDB Atlas schema — engineer states, ownership map, events, nudges
infra/ DigitalOcean App Platform deploy spec + Dockerfile
shared/ Shared TypeScript types
